Market Challenges and Restraints

Despite promising growth prospects, the South Korea near range lidar market faces several challenges that could temper its expansion. High costs associated with advanced lidar sensors remain a significant barrier, especially for SMEs and cost-sensitive applications. Regulatory complexities, particularly around data privacy and safety standards, can delay deployment and increase compliance costs.

Infrastructure limitations, such as the need for supporting connectivity and power supply in certain regions, may hinder widespread adoption. Additionally, intense market competition among local and international players can lead to pricing pressures and innovation race dynamics, potentially impacting profit margins. Supply chain constraints, especially in sourcing high-quality components, could also impact production timelines and scalability.
